Output d01d8a4cd2820c23f29f13a2ca1745a94f99e0e64b2996acddbb471f4a9336e5:1

value
2297000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d28a05b88e753348907b1c74e1d6e772047fb6 OP_EQUAL
address
3BLZ6ChZq2RntrRrW5wsmYPHTFv8x7r9QC
transaction
d01d8a4cd2820c23f29f13a2ca1745a94f99e0e64b2996acddbb471f4a9336e5
spent
true